iShares MSCI Global Metals & Mining Producers ETF
PICK
PICK
137 hedge funds and large institutions have $564M invested in iShares MSCI Global Metals & Mining Producers ETF in 2022 Q3 according to their latest regulatory filings, with 16 funds opening new positions, 52 increasing their positions, 31 reducing their positions, and 25 closing their positions.
